Korea Investment & Securities estimates SK Hynix Q2 revenue at 80.9 trln won and operating profit at 60.4 trln won, up 264% and 556% YoY respectively, but about 8% below the 65 trln won market consensus. Analyst Chae Min-suk said SK Hynix’s higher share of high-bandwidth memory (HBM), whose ASP gains have labeled the market, caps company-level ASP increases; with HBM4 entering full production and sales from Q3, ASP growth should align with the market. KIS estimates Q2 DRAM and NAND ASPs rose roughly 30% and 50% QoQ. The broker cut its operating-profit forecasts for this year and 2027 by 9% and 11%, saying the revisions reflect more realistic price assumptions tied to signed long-term contracts. Chae added that as the memory industry shifts toward 3–5 year contract structures, companies value will depend on how long higher profitability persists rather than quarterly ASP growth rates.
